
This fruit salad is a bright, refreshing bowl of color and flavor that feels equally at home as a light dessert, a brunch side, or a midday snack. Red and green grapes bring natural sweetness and a satisfying pop, while crisp apple slices add a little tartness and texture to every bite. The honey-ginger dressing is where things get really interesting โ a quick whisk of honey, fresh lemon juice, and finely grated ginger creates something zippy and aromatic without relying on any warming spices that might cause concern. Ceylon cinnamon adds a gentle, almost floral warmth that's noticeably softer and more delicate than the cassia variety, making it a smart choice for anyone keeping a close eye on their spice cabinet. Fresh mint scattered over the top lifts the whole dish and makes it look genuinely stunning with almost zero extra effort. It comes together in minutes and can be made slightly ahead, so it's a stress-free option when you need something crowd-pleasing on the table fast.

In a small bowl, whisk together the honey, lemon juice, grated ginger, and ground Ceylon cinnamon until the honey is fully dissolved and the dressing is smooth.
Add the halved red and green grapes and sliced apples to a large mixing bowl.
